MKG-RAG-Bench
MKG-RAG-Bench is a benchmark for retrieval in multimodal knowledge graph-augmented generation, constructed from two knowledge graphs (general and medical) with QA datasets supporting controlled evaluation of retrieval and generation. It uses an LLM-based curation pipeline for structurally grounded queries.

Why it matters
Isolates retrieval as a first-class evaluation target in MKG-RAG, addressing the challenge of heterogeneous multimodal knowledge. It provides a foundation for diagnosing retrieval limitations and improving end-to-end RAG systems.
Motivation
Ret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) over knowledge graphs has emerged as a promising approach for grounding large language models, yet existing benchmarks largely overlook the challenges of retrieval in multimodal knowledge graph RAG (MKG-RAG).
